lol no they're not. Go look at any PSU game the last 2 years- JoMo wants air under the ball so the Wr can adjust to it, get in position, and go up for it. A line drive means that it's an easy deflection/pick if the cb is between the QB and Wr, and it gives no way for the Wr to adjust on anything less than a perfect throw. Go watch McSorely highlights on YT- every ball over 30 yards has air under it
Fitz has always thrown it flat and too hard, it's not what the new staff is teaching him
